My throat is always blocked. I need to burp to get comfortable. What's going on?

1. Functional dyspepsia
Gastrointestinal motility disorders, Helicobacter pylori infection and other factors can cause functional dyspepsia. Patients with gastric emptying disorders, gastric contents in the intestinal fermentation will produce a lot of gas, and then appear the above symptoms.
2. Reflux esophagitis
Reflux esophagitis is considered to be related to the weakening of esophageal mucosal defense barrier, anti-reflux function decline and other factors. Patients with esophageal mucosal damage, reflux, heartburn, belching, belching and other symptoms.
3. Autonomic nerve disorders
The balance between sympathetic and parasympathetic nerves is broken, which can lead to digestive system dysfunction, the above symptoms occur.
